Just got a gander at NBC's fall schedule. Sad to say, MEDIUM has been let go along with MY NAME IS EARL.

Many of their dramas are going to have mini-seasons. CHUCK and HEROES, for example, will only air 13 episodes during the season and then leave the air for other 13-week series to take over.
Which sounds like broadcast network television is following the lead of cable network television (which followed the lead from Brit television) - shorter seasons, which will cut down on expenses (I hope) and maybe result in better writing/directing/etc (I hope).

But I'm not holding my breath.

Johnson's Dancing With The Stars Pay Revealed27 March 2009 2:37 AM, PDT | From Studio Briefing | See recent Studio Briefing news

 
Since Shawn Johnson, the Olympic gymnast who is now appearing on Dancing With the Stars, is a minor, her DWTS contract had to be filed in court, where the TMZ.com website was able to get hold of it. Disclosing details of the contract Thursday, TMZ said that it guarantees Shawn $125,000 for appearing on the show, then $10,000 a week for weeks 3 and 4. Her payment doubles to $20,000 a week for weeks 5, 6 and 7 -- if she remains on the show, then earns $30,000 a week for weeks 8 and 9. If she makes it to weeks 10 and 11, she'll be paid $50,000 a week.
